DN33 is a postcode district in Brigg and Immingham. Homes here sold for a median of £168,250 over the last year, up 5.2% over five years. 9,979 sales are on record. It sits among England’s less-deprived areas (57% of its postcodes are in the least-deprived 30%). 56% of homes are rated EPC C or better.
